LONDON, DEC 11 : England have named their Test squad for the tour of India in January next year with a new-look spin attack featuring four spinners.
Skipper Ben Stokes will lead a new-look England Test team for the ICC World Test Championship series in India next year.
Shoaib Bashir, who has only played six first-class games, is one among four spinners that make the touring party. Jack Leach will lead the spin attack which also has Rehan Ahmed and left-arm spinner Tom Hartley, an ICC report on Monday said.
Chris Woakes, Liam Dawson and Will Jacks were notable omissions from the squad. James Anderson will lead the pace attack in India with uncapped Gus Atkinson making the promotion from the limited-overs squad. Mark Wood and Ollie Robinson are the other pacers in the squad.
Meanwhile, there was also a recall for wicketkeeper Ben Foakes, who missed out from the Ashes squad earlier in the year. Jonny Bairstow is the other wicketkeeper in the squad. Ollie Pope and Leach also return from injuries.
The first Test of the series is in Hyderabad from January 25.
England Test squad: Ben Stokes (c), Rehan Ahmed, James Anderson, Gus Atkinson, Jonny Bairstow, Shoaib Bashir, Harry Brook, Zak Crawley, Ben Duckett, Ben Foakes, Tom Hartley,
Jack Leach, Ollie Pope, Ollie Robinson, Joe Root, Mark Wood.(UNI)
